** Job Description Summary
** The Student Services Manager provides strategic leadership for the development, delivery, and continuous improvement of undergraduate and graduate programs in the Department of Geography. The Department offers a broad suite of programs spanning the Faculties of Arts and Science, including the BSc Major in Geographical Sciences, BA Major in Human Geography, BA Major in Environment and Sustainability, BA Major in Urban Studies, Minor in Human Geography, Minor in Environment and Sustainability, Minor in Urban Studies, Minor Geographical Info Science and Geographic Computation (GIS&GC), Certificate in Climate Studies and Action, and MA, MSc, and PhD degrees.

The role supports a large and complex student population, including over 500 undergraduate majors, 200 minors, 80 certificate students, and approximately 5,700 undergraduate course enrolments across 75 sections. The graduate program comprises roughly 100 master’s and doctoral students.

This position leads key student services functions such as program planning, admissions evaluation, outreach and recruitment initiatives, and academic advising that fosters student success, retention, and career development. The Manager acts as a central liaison with internal and external partners to ensure coordinated service  addition, the role oversees staff supervision, teaching assistant appointments, student awards, budgets, and departmental events, ensuring efficient operations and alignment with institutional priorities and policies.

** Organizational Status
** Reports to the Administrator. The incumbent works independently, with initiative and considerable autonomy. Takes direction from the Head and Associate Heads.

** Work Performed*
* ** Program Leadership & Strategy
*** Leads planning, delivery, and continuous improvement of undergraduate and graduate programs, including recruitment, admissions, and advising.
* Provides strategic analysis and recommendations on enrolment management, curriculum delivery, course scheduling, and student services.
* Co-chairs undergraduate committees and advises the graduate committee.
** Academic Advising
*** Manages undergraduate and graduate admissions, including holistic evaluation of applicants and enrolment planning.
* Provides expert academic advising on degree requirements, progression, and career pathways.
* Assesses transfer credit, program eligibility, course registration, and graduation requirements.
* Advises students on academic and personal challenges; connects students with campus supports and services.
* Supports student success, retention, and progression through proactive outreach and case management.
